well its too bad you cant select any options easier with the map. do you really have to go to the xml every time to select which nations you want to exist with on the map? isnt there someway to take the map into 'custom game' and setup your options that way? or is that only for random generated map types?

im kinda dissapointed if not because 99.99% of my civ3 games were all played on a scenario where i chose the other civs and other aspects of the game, without editing any xml...


EDIT: and anyone who is trying to figure out how to do this to cut down the civs....you dont just delete the entries, you have to delete the stuff between beginplayer and endplayer..
